SSSS.DYNAZENONダイナゼノン (Dainazenon) is an anime series produced by Tsuburaya Productions in collaboration with Studio Trigger, first unveiled at Tsuburaya Convention in December 2019.[1] The series is set to premiere in April 2, 2021[2] as the second installment in the GRIDMAN UNIVERSE project after SSSS.GRIDMAN.[3][4]

Synopsis

One day on his way home, a first-year student of Fujiyokidai High School named Yomogi Asanaka meets a mysterious man named Gauma who claims to be a "Monster Tamer". Suddenly, a Kaiju and a giant robot, Dynazenon, appear! Yume Minami, Koyomi Yamanaka, and Chise Asukagawa also happen to be passing by, and together with Yomogi they are caught up in a battle with the Kaiju.[5]

Voice Drama

As a follow up to each episode, an original voice drama is uploaded to Pony Canyon Anime's YouTube channel, for a duration of one week much like the previous series.
